Take Fred, Heavy and Fat Boy's words to heart. Six months was the difference between me keeping a line and all of my buds in my reserve unit from my company being furloughed. This story repeats itself throughout history and into the future on a never ending loop with only the names changing. I'm sympathetic you like your job, but the hiring is beginning. If you think you want to wait until more are hiring, it definitely improves your chances of going right from a government paycheck to airline paycheck, but seniority is everything in the airlines.

I'm honestly not sure I could stomach the regional world. It makes sense but I'm not sure I could do that. It's not arrogance--I don't think the majors are lining up to hire me. But if I can't get to a major I'd probably find something outside aviation.
The reserves aren't an option for you, so you'll need a flying job to fall back on for currency in case a major doesn't hire you right away.
